Eating Healthy To Help You Lose Weight

     Fad diets can help you lose weight quickly, but won't help you keep it off because often you'll fall back into your same unhealthy eating habits. One of the best ways to lose weight and keep the weight off is to change your eating habits to healthier habits.

Evaluate your diet before making any changes to it. For three of four days, keep a food journal and write down everything that you eat during the day and when during the day you ate. It may also be a good idea to keep try of why you were eating. Finding out exactly what you eat, when you eat and why you eat will help you make healthier changes to your eating habits.

After realizing what you eat decide what you need to change. Do you eat a lot of food containing high amounts of fat or calories? Consider cutting down on refined carbohydrates like cakes, cookies, biscuits, sweets and candy. This can be especially helpful if you are trying to lose belly fat. Replace this type of food with whole grains, fruits and vegetables. If you are eating these kinds of foods as snacks try replacing them with fruits or vegetables. Fresh or dried fruit has natural sugars that will help your sugar craving, but are a healthier alternative to candy.

Next evaluate when you are eating. Do you snack constantly during the day or do you eat three specific meals? Are you eating breakfast and are you eating late at night. If you are snacking on candy or some other sweet treat all day, consider changing your habits to have just three specific meals and don't eat any time besides those three meals. If you need to eat more often than that, consider having more meals through the day, but smaller meals. The time of day that you eat is important to consider as well. Eating meals late at night or right before you go to bed doesn't allow your body time to use the energy from those meals and will store the energy as fat.

Last, consider why you eat. Do you eat a lot of comfort foods to help make you feel better after a stressful day? Do you eat out a lot with your friends and your family socially? If you are eating a lot of fatty foods to help relieve stress, consider finding different ways to relieve stress. Meditate or do deep breathing exercises. Find ways to unwind after a stressful day through different hobbies and try to cut stress eating out of your diet entirely. Also, if you are eating out a lot with friends and family, find healthy options on menus. Before going to a restaurant look online and find information about how many calories the dishes contain and choose healthier food. Also, consider sharing your meal with a friend or family member to cut down on the amount of food you are eating. Restaurant portion sizes are often much larger than necessary. You can also eat all of the salad before the meal to take the edge off your appetite and help you to eat less of the main course.

While changing your eating habits to create a healthier diet remember that your body needs energy from food to accomplish your daily activities. Starving yourself is not a healthy way to lose weight. Instead change your eating habits to help you accomplish your weight loss goals.
